Atomic built the Hatchet Freestyle Snowboard so well that their pros ride it off-the-shelf for launching backcountry booters, park hits, and rails. Considered a reference for all-mountain snowboards, the Hatchet is Atomic’s consistent number one seller. Atomic gives the Hatchet the same durable poplar core found in their freeride boards, while the full 2.5-degree bottom-edge Park Bevel minimizes hang ups on rails, park targets, and backcountry jib hits that aren’t as well-maintained. D4 Sandwich Construction uses four independent glass layers to maximize pop and response while maintaining consistent flex and a stable feel underfoot. The generous park edge also gives you some forgiveness if you should launch or land a little off center.
